#c8bb73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c8bb73 is composed of 78.4% red, 73.3%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 42.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 50.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 61.8%. #c8bb73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#917700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#c8bb73 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.

#c8bb73 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c8bb73 has RGB values of R:200, G:187,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.43,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13155187.

Shades and Tints of #c8bb73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#faf9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8bb73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a199 is the less saturated color, while #fddf3f is the most saturated one.
